101-95, the Lakers, who lost to the Nuggets in the last game with a huge 37-point difference, finally found the feeling of winning in the West's old third Jazz. It was also the first time since Anthony Davis' injury that they had beaten the top eight "strong teams" in the East and West.

The Lakers in the new season have encountered various difficulties, the integration of Wei Shao and the existing lineup is not smooth, the lineup cobbled together by the base salary, it is difficult to find role players who can stably provide contributions for a while, coupled with continuous injuries, so that the Lakers frequently change the starting lineup, adjust the rotation, it is difficult to establish a stable formation combination, and the chemical reaction is naturally impossible to talk about.

In the away battle against the Timberwolves on December 18, Thick Brow accidentally suffered a knee injury, and since then, he has hung up the exemption card, and it has been exactly one month since today. The Lakers, who were even worse off, tried all kinds of ways during this period, and even used the strange move of making James the starting center, and they were able to achieve 5 wins and 9 losses, and the win rate in the league was the bottom of the league in the same period. In the last game against the Nuggets, they suffered a terrible defeat 96-133.

Facing the Jazz at home today, the Lakers' task is even more difficult. Although the other side has just suffered a wave of 4 consecutive defeats, it is mainly because when the center Rudy Gobert triggered the health and safety agreement, he could not play. In the last game Gobert returned, the Jazz immediately beat the Nuggets. According to statistics, when the former defensive player of the year was on the floor this season, the Jazz won 28 and lost 10, second only to the league's number one Sun in terms of winning percentage.

In stark contrast to the Lakers: The Jazz have the most consistent starting combination in the league, and their opening five have played 462 minutes together this season, ranking first in the league. The Lakers' most commonly used starting combination has only 67 minutes to work together, which is almost equivalent to a fraction of the other side.

Anyway, the Lakers simply won by surprise and tried to change the team again: in addition to letting Dwight Howard continue to start and play against Gobert, Vogel also removed Malik Munch, who has recently been in hot form, to the bench, and let veteran Trevo Ariza and James partner up front.

This adjustment not only increased the height of the starting lineup to curb the Jazz's interior advantage, but also enhanced the bench firepower. In addition to this, Vogel also continued to try to find his winning code through constant "trial and error".

According to statistics, this is the 22nd starting lineup that the Lakers have tried this season, which is the first in the league. From the beginning of the season to the present, the Lakers have had 14 players before and after the start. These data, in addition to illustrating the huge impact of injuries on the team, also reflect the embarrassment of the Lakers' situation:

The Lakers' big three have a total annual salary of $121 million, which has exceeded the league salary cap, so even if they are willing to pay the luxury tax, they can only rely on the bottom salary players to fill the gaps except for Bird Rights to renew Tucker and mini middle class to introduce Nairn. Among the five "non-base salary players" in the Lakers' team at present, Thick Brow and Nunn cannot play due to injury, and the performance of Westbrook and Tucker is difficult to say, so they can only desperately dig inside and try to find a few candidates who can really help in a group of low-salary players.

In order to achieve this goal, the Lakers have reused Bazemore, Ellington, Jordan Jr., given Jobs to Thomas Jr. and Collison Jr., and although there have been many failed attempts, they have gradually begun to gain.

Munch has performed well since his return from the new crown on December 26, averaging 3.4 three-pointers per game with 49.3 percent shooting and hitting 18.6 points, becoming the second point of fire in the team outside of James. Even off the bench today, he still played resolutely, contributing 14 points and 7 rebounds on 6-of-12 shooting.

Another big surprise was Stanley Johnson, who joined as a short-contract player at the hardest hit by the team and immediately earned credibility with his athleticism and defensive performances. There are reports that a key reason why the Lakers sent away veteran Rondo was to make room for a renewed contract with the former lotto show.

Johnson, who just signed the third ten-day short contract with the Lakers today, immediately proved his value again, he came off the bench to become a Miracle, contributing 15 points, 5 rebounds, 3 assists, 1 steal and 2 blocks in 9 shots, of which the fourth quarter faced Gobert dared to fight, continuous misplaced single eating, a single quarter cut 10 points, but also grabbed a key frontcourt rebound 2 minutes and 39 seconds before the final game, becoming the biggest X factor in the game.

It has to be mentioned that rookie Austin Reeves, a young player who once killed the lone ranger by three points, although there are only 4 points, 5 rebounds and 1 assist on the data column today, he spares no effort in defense, excellent transfer of the ball, and has become an important lubricant that the data cannot reflect. Three minutes and 49 seconds before the final, he broke through the basket and missed it, but shot himself, and his left hand pointed the ball into the basket, rewriting the score to 91-87, which was also a valuable goal.
